Top Off-Road Routes to Explore
Now for the fun part: the trails! Hungary offers a variety of off-road routes. Each route promises a unique experience. One popular option is the Zemplén Mountains. This region in northeast Hungary boasts winding trails, dense forests, and challenging ascents. It's a true test for any off-road vehicle. Another great option is the Bükk National Park. This park offers a diverse landscape of mountains, valleys, and forests. The trails here range from moderate to difficult, providing something for all skill levels. For a more relaxed experience, head to the Great Hungarian Plain. This vast, open space offers a unique off-road experience. You can enjoy long stretches of dirt roads and sandy tracks. For those seeking a taste of history, consider exploring the trails around the Aggtelek Karst. This area is known for its stunning caves and unique geological formations. Be sure to check local regulations and obtain any necessary permits before heading out. Always respect the environment and practice responsible off-roading.

Safety First: Essential Tips for a Safe Off-Roading Experience
Alright, guys, before we get too carried away with the adventure, let's talk about safety. Because let's be real, safety is key to having a great time off-roading. First things first: always go with a buddy. There is safety in numbers, and having another vehicle or a group of friends can be a lifesaver in case of emergencies. Make sure you have the right recovery gear. This includes a winch, tow straps, and a snatch block. Learn how to use this equipment. A first-aid kit is a must. You never know when you'll need it. Always check the weather forecast before you head out. Unexpected rain or snow can make trails much more challenging and dangerous. Ensure your vehicle is in top condition. This includes regular maintenance and pre-trip inspections. Familiarize yourself with your vehicle's capabilities and limitations. Do not push your vehicle beyond its limits. Know the trail conditions before you start your adventure. Check local regulations and obtain any necessary permits. Always practice responsible off-roading. Respect the environment and leave no trace.
Prioritizing Safety: Key Considerations Before Hitting the Trails
Before you even think about hitting the trails, here are a few key things to keep in mind to ensure a safe and enjoyable off-roading experience. Always inform someone of your route and estimated return time. This is a crucial safety measure. Always have a fully charged cell phone. Cellular service can be spotty in remote areas, so consider carrying a satellite communication device or personal locator beacon. Make sure your vehicle is properly equipped for off-roading. This includes appropriate tires, suspension, and protection. Never attempt a trail that is beyond your skill level or your vehicle's capabilities. Take a recovery course. Know how to use your recovery gear. Always be aware of your surroundings. Keep an eye out for other vehicles, wildlife, and changing weather conditions. Be prepared for emergencies. Pack extra food, water, and clothing. Make sure you have a basic understanding of vehicle repair and maintenance. Follow these safety tips, and you will have an unforgettable off-roading experience.
